This week on Unapologetically Us The Podcast, we officially entered Rotisserie Mode. 😂

What started as a conversation about sharing locations somehow turned into debates about shower routines, read receipts, cruise life, bidets, all-inclusive resorts, gym struggles, and the absolute chaos of adult friendships.

David and Jenn break down why turning your location off is suspicious, whether people are secretly “location collectors,” why shower direction apparently matters way more than it should, and if bidets are actually life changing or just aggressive toilet accessories.
